Stampede 03-10-2004 04:33 AM
Have you watched enough Trigun to know that
spoiler (highlight to read):
Vash isn't a person at all, but a super-being?


That's just the thing. The difference between Kenshin is that Kenshin is a normal human who happens to be really, really good at swordfighting. Vash is so far beyond us that it's not even funny. For example, in Episode 23, he manages to triangulate a person's location by calculating the trajectory that bullets hit things, timing the rifle reports, and calculating distance. He does all this while evading gunfire, by the way. Likewise, he figures out the exact spots he needs to hit the fist of Gosef Nebraska, which is the size and mass of a bus, to change its flight path, all in a matter of seconds. That's why Vash is so unwilling to kill anyone- because he is so intelligent and able to think of solutions faster and better than a regular person, he believes that he should never have to resort to that, but be able to think through his problems and find a way to save everyone.
